Your first paragraph looks misguided to me: does it imply we should "believe" matrix multiplication is defined by the naive algorithm for small n, and the Strassen and Coppersmith-Winograd algorithms for larger values of n? Your second paragraph, on the other hand, makes exactly the point I was trying to make in the original post: we can assign degrees of belief to equivalence classes of theories that give the same observable predictions.
